What is the drill bit 7/32 and how it fits into drill bit sizing systems

The drill bit 7/32 is a fractional inch size that occupies a specific position in standard drill sets. For DIY enthusiasts and professionals, understanding where 7/32 fits between nearby sizes helps you plan hole tolerances and drill sequences more effectively. According to Drill Bits Pro, the 7/32 size is a practical choice when you need holes that are larger than 3/16 inch but smaller than 1/4 inch, offering a balance between tool strength and hole clearance. This size is common across wood, metal, and plastic projects, making it a staple in many toolkits. The 7/32 inch diameter translates to approximately 0.21875 inches, which matters when you’re matching a screw shank or a fastener with a predrilled hole. In practice, the choice of drill bit 7/32 should align with your material’s hardness, the drill’s RPM range, and the tolerance you require. Drill Bits Pro emphasizes checking manufacturers’ charts to confirm the exact diameter and flute geometry before committing to a project, ensuring accuracy and consistent results.

  • Position in the sizing ladder: between 3/16 and 1/4 inches
  • Common applications: pilot holes, fastener clearance, and precise hole sizing
  • Practical consideration: match to the material and fastener for best results

What is a drill bit 7/32 and what is it used for?

A drill bit 7/32 is a fractional inch size with a diameter of 7/32 inch, used to create holes of that exact size. It is versatile for woodworking, metalworking, and plastics where a precise hole is required.

Can I use a drill bit 7/32 on metal?

Yes, you can use a 7/32 bit on certain metals, especially softer steels or aluminum, with proper speed and lubrication. For harder metals, choose a bit with appropriate material and geometry to reduce wear.

Is 7/32 the same as 11/64?

No. 7/32 equals 0.21875 inches, while 11/64 equals 0.171875 inches. They are different standard fractional sizes and yield different hole diameters.
